Example of Essential Functions:

  • Obtains and records patient’s vital signs and weight.
  • Assists patients to disrobe providing protection of privacy and care of personal possessions.
  • Initiates cardiac monitoring and performs 12 Lead EKG’s as directed.
  • Performs venipuncture, inserts and/or discontinues intravenous catheters, obtains venous blood specimens
  • Performs orthopedic splinting including OCL cast application, crutch fitting and teaching, soft cast application, and fitting/application of other various orthopedic support devices.
  • Performs point of care testing as directed.
  • Performs blood glucose monitoring as directed.
  • Assists in morgue care.
  • Assists in transferring a patient to diagnostic areas using a stretcher and/or wheelchair.
  • Assists in preparing a patient for discharge or transfer.
  • Prepares the patient area for incoming patients.
  • Performs equipment checklist as assigned.
  • Reports variances of equipment performance to the Charge Nurse.
  • Uses equipment according to manufacturer guidelines and department standards.
  • Functions as a member of the Code Blue and Go Teams.
  • Performs close observation according to the hospital standards and guidelines.
  • Contributes ideas on recommendations of solutions to increase efficiency and promote cost containment and quality of care.
  • Demonstrates proper phone etiquette.

About Frederick Health

Frederick Health provides comprehensive healthcare services to residents of Frederick County, MD. The system includes Frederick Health Hospital (founded in 1902), Frederick Health Medical Group, Frederick Health Employer Solutions, Frederick Health Home Care, and Frederick Health Hospice.

Frederick Health Medical Group is a multi-specialty practice with more than 100 providers, 17 specialties, and multiple locations across the county. The system has several ambulatory care locations, a freestanding cancer institute, two urgent care locations, and Frederick Health Village.

With over 3,000 employees, Frederick Health provides a full spectrum of healthcare and wellness services to support its mission to positively impact the well-being of every individual in our community.
